How the formula works

Both carat per cubic meter and decigram per oil barrel meas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in carat per cubic meter by 0.317975 to get decigram per oil barrel. To reverse the conversion, multiply a decigram per oil barrel value by 3.144905 to get back to carat per cubic meter.
